- Monitoring of all 3-phase grids from 200 V to 690 V nominal voltage
- Frequency monitoring from 15-70 Hz for more detailed information
- IO-Link enables transmission and evaluation of measured values in the
controller or higher-level systems
- Certification according to SIL 1 (IEC 62061) and PL c (EN ISO 13849-1)
standards for a wide range of applications
Siemens has launched a new generation of line monitoring relays. The SIRIUS 3UG5 line monitoring relays combine proven technology with new functions and applications. The relays are the easiest way to monitor standards-compliant grid stability and quality, ensuring proper system operation and a long service life of components such as motors or compressors. Grid monitoring relays are used in critical areas such as hospitals or the process industry, which require a high-quality, fail-safe supply of power. Other areas of application include cranes, elevators, air, and air-conditioning compressors, as well as the timber industry.

- Industrial Connectivity Lab opens at the Erlangen site
- Test environment for industrial connectivity technologies
- 5G, WLAN, RTLS, and RFID: Users test application scenarios and interoperability in industrial conditions
The technology company Siemens has opened a new test laboratory for industrial connectivity technologies at its Erlangen site. Embedded in the Siemens Technology Center on the Erlangen campus, the Industrial Connectivity Lab offers 300 square meters of space for extensive testing of any connectivity solution in industrial environments: Industrial WLAN, 5G, real-time localization systems (RTLS), and radio frequency identification (RFID).
- Innovative Sentron 3WA circuit breaker series part of Siemens Xcelerator
- Designed to improve ease of use, reliability, and digitalization when integrating into existing systems
- Essential for critical infrastructure, such as hospitals or data centers
- 3WA1 (IEC), 3WA2 (UL489), and 3WA3 (UL1066+IEC) offer worldwide compatibility
Siemens has launched two new additional
versions of its innovative Sentron 3WA Power Circuit Breakers, alternatively
known as Air Circuit Breakers (ACBs). Series 3WA3 meets the requirements of UL
1066 and IEC 60947-2 standards, which enables customers to use it worldwide.
This is particularly advantageous for switchgear manufacturers and OEMs producing
systems for both standardization areas – IEC and UL. The 3WA2 series is
designed exclusively for the UL 489 market. The two new ACB model series
complement the 3WA1 version for IEC markets, which has been launched in the
fall of 2020. Siemens offers a full range of ACBs which are based on a
consistent system and offer great flexibility for applications around the
globe. The Sentron 3WA Power Circuit Breakers are part of the Siemens
Xcelerator portfolio. Siemens Xcelerator is an open digital business platform
that enables customers to accelerate their digital transformation easier,
faster, and at scale.
